#22The Supercharger network is one of their remaining competitive advantages. Other manufacturers were behind for years on efficiency, range, etc. but are now catching up - and other manufacturers are far better at making an actual _car_ than Tesla. Build quality, quality control, durability, comfort, noise, etc.
Unless Tesla is so confident that their manufacturing skills will give them a continuing and durable cost advantage - that makes up for the fact that they haven't innovated or even improved their basic vehicle design for the past 10 years - I don't see how this works to their advantage.

> CCS is done Who are the remaining CCS adherents?
That said, there are two CCS standards, one for (older) Japanese and American vehicles (SAE J1772), and another widely used in Europe (IEC 62196 Type). Both have been designed to be as backwards compatible with older charging standards as possible.
European Teslas ship with CCS Type 2 so I doubt this will have any impact on Volvos outside the USA.

The list of Manufacturers on board at this time: Ford, GM, Rivian, Volvo (and presumably Polstar).
Hyundai and Stellantis are considering it. If they join, and it'd be silly not to at this point, that's about half the car market right there. Now it's just up to the German and Japanese automakers.

It's estimated America will need around 2mm EV chargers by 2030; it currently has about 160k [1]. Every charger currently deployed is less than a tenth of what we need in seven years. That's not quite tabula rasa, but it's close.
CCS lost because it prioritized backward compatibility in an environment where most of what's needed must be built. The difference between sticking with existing infrastructure and retrofitting is, in the grand scheme, a rounding error and so properly ignored.
